Apart from that, I came home like flying. I love movies like that, movies that "talk" about trips. It is so amazing to see the places on the big screen. Then I tried to remember the best movies like that I watched. Here it goes a small list...
1. Everything is illuminated: a Jewish boy travels to Ukraine to discover a bit of his grandaddy's life. It is lovely and funny;
2. One week: a man came across with a cancer and before getting married, he travels along Canada. Oh Canada!;
3. Elizabethtown: a man just about to commit suicide has to travel to a small city to his dad's funeral. After that, he starts a journey to leave his dad's ashes along US. And there is a kind of scrapbook in it. And the soundtrack is unbelieveable!;
4. Into the wild: after finished his BA, a young boy starts backpacking along US. He intents to finish his trip in Alaska. The soundtrack is amazing as well, loaded with musics by Eddie Vedder! Cool!;
5. Up: a senior man had promissed to his wife to take her to South America, but she dies before happening it. Then he puts a lot of ballons in his house and flies to there, but there is also Russel, a scout boy who makes company to Mr. Karl. I love Russel!
